Default Sunvisor vanity mirror hinge fix with videos

the cover to the drivers side vanity mirror broke at one of the hinges. I assumed I could just take off the whole mirror assembly and glue the hinge and I would be all set. What I was not aware of is that the mirror is fastened to the sun visor with dainty plastic posts that are melted on the back, so they are impossible to remove without breaking pretty much all of them. So I was left with a decision to try to fix what I have or spend 2-3 hundred on a new sun visor. I am not opposed to spending money on my car, but I gotta draw the line somewhere. Below are videos of how I chose to reattach the mirror assembly. I used .029 brass wire which is roughly .75 mm, if that's how you measure things, but I am sure you could just get utility wire from lowes or home depot, I have some but it was too thick for what I wanted, and I am a toolmaker at a jewelry chain shop so I just bought 3 dollars worth of wire. I will say that I tried to take off the sunvisor but I did not have any success. I researched how to, but sometimes experience tells you that your pushing too hard and will likely break something.
